(The Center Square) –The cost of living in California is driving up the cost of raising children in the Golden State, new from SmartAsset shows.

The study, published in July, shows that the San Francisco Bay Area is the most expensive place to raise a child in the United States. Families in the San Francisco-Oakland-Fremont area will pay $43,171 in 2026 to raise a kid there, followed closely by families in nearby San Jose. Families in the San Jose-Sunnyvale-Santa Clara area will pay $41,817 to raise a child there this year. That put the San Jose metropolitan area at the third-most expensive place in the country to raise a kid, that study shows.
